According to Muzafer Sherif, conflict between groups—also known as intergroup conflict—occurs when two groups are vying for the same scarce resources. Evidence from a well-known research looking at group conflict lends credence to this theory: The Robbers Cave Study.
These possibilities were investigated in the robbers cave study:
- Unknown individuals will form a group structure with hierarchical roles and statuses when they are brought together to cooperate in group activities in order to accomplish shared goals.
- Two in-groups will develop attitudes and appropriate hostile behaviours toward the out-group and its members when they are brought into functional interaction under competitive and group-frustrating circumstances. These behaviours will be standardised and shared to varied degrees by group members.
